Understanding Electrical Adapters
Electrical adapters are vital components in our modern electrical systems. They serve as converters that allow the connection between devices and power sources, ensuring compatibility with different voltages and plug types. To grasp the significance of these devices, it is essential to understand their various forms and functions.
In essence, electrical adapters facilitate the flow of electricity to devices that require specific voltage or current types. This capability enables users to utilize a wide array of electronic devices across various environments, from home to industrial settings. The convenience they offer is undeniable, but this convenience comes with the critical responsibility of choosing the right adapter.
The Importance of Quality in Adapters
When it comes to electrical adapters, **quality matters** significantly. A reliable adapter not only ensures optimal performance but also safeguards devices from potential damage. Inferior-quality adapters can lead to a host of issues, including overheating, electrical surges, and even fire hazards.
High-quality adapters are designed and manufactured to meet specific safety standards, which minimizes the risk of malfunction. They are typically made from durable materials that can withstand varying environmental conditions, ensuring longevity and consistent performance. Investing in a quality electrical adapter is an investment in both device safety and efficiency.
Key Features of Reliable Electrical Adapters
To ensure that you are choosing a **reliable electrical adapter**, look for the following key features:
1. Safety Certifications
Adapters should have safety certifications, such as UL (Underwriters Laboratories), CE (Conformité Européenne), or FCC (Federal Communications Commission). These certifications indicate that the product has undergone rigorous testing and adheres to safety standards.
2. Voltage Compatibility
Ensure the adapter matches the voltage requirements of your device. An adapter that provides the incorrect voltage can lead to device malfunction or damage. Always check the specifications of both the adapter and the device it will power.
3. Amperage Rating
The amperage rating is crucial; it should meet or exceed the device's requirements. Overloading an adapter can result in overheating and short-circuiting.
4. Build Quality
Durable materials such as high-quality plastic and metal components enhance an adapter's reliability. Examine the build quality; it should feel robust and secure.
5. Overload Protection
Some adapters come equipped with overload or short-circuit protection features. These safety measures automatically disconnect power in the event of a surge, protecting both the adapter and the connected devices.
Common Types of Electrical Adapters
Understanding the various types of electrical adapters can help in selecting the right one for your needs. Here are some of the most common types:
1. Travel Adapters
These adapters allow devices to connect to different plug types used in various countries. They usually do not convert voltage but enable physical connectivity.
2. Power Grids and Socket Adapters
These adapters connect devices to a power grid, adjusting for voltage and amperage as needed. They are crucial for appliances and tools that require specific electrical input.
3. USB Adapters
USB adapters facilitate the connection of devices to USB power sources. They are widely used for charging smartphones, tablets, and other portable devices.
4. AC to DC Adapters
These adapters convert alternating current (AC) from a wall outlet into direct current (DC), which many devices require. They are commonly used for laptops and other electronic equipment.
How to Choose the Right Adapter
Selecting the right electrical adapter involves several considerations:
1. Assess Your Device’s Requirements
Before purchasing, check the voltage and amperage requirements of your device. This information is often found on the device itself or in its user manual.
2. Determine Compatibility
Make sure the adapter is compatible with the specific type of plug used in your region or intended location. Using an incompatible adapter can lead to inefficiency or damage.
3. Research Brands
Read reviews and research reputable brands that specialize in electrical adapters. Quality brands often have a proven track record of reliability and safety standards.
4. Compare Prices
While quality is essential, price can be a determining factor. Compare options within your budget, but avoid compromising on quality for a lower price.
5. Purchase from Reputable Retailers
Buy adapters from established retailers or manufacturers to ensure authenticity. Avoid purchasing from unknown sources, especially online, where counterfeit products may be prevalent.
Safety Considerations for Electrical Adapters
Safety is paramount when dealing with electrical adapters. Here are essential safety tips to keep in mind:
1. Avoid Overloading
Never exceed the adapter's rated load. Overloading can cause overheating, leading to potential electrical fires.
2. Inspect Regularly
Check your adapters for any signs of wear, damage, or fraying cables. If any issues are found, replace the adapter immediately to avoid hazards.
3. Use in Dry Conditions
Keep adapters away from moisture. Using them in wet conditions can lead to short circuits and electrocution.
4. Don't Modify Adapters
Modifying an electrical adapter can void its warranty and compromise safety. Always use it as intended by the manufacturer.
5. Store Properly
When not in use, store adapters in a cool, dry place. Proper storage can prolong their lifespan and maintain safety.
Maintenance and Care for Adapters
Taking care of your electrical adapters can enhance their performance and lifespan. Here are some maintenance tips:
1. Keep Connections Clean
Dust and debris can accumulate on the connectors, affecting performance. Regularly clean the connectors with a soft, dry cloth.
2. Avoid Excessive Bending
Frequent bending of the cords can lead to internal damage. Handle the cords with care and store them straight.
3. Check for Updates
Stay informed about any recalls or safety notices related to your adapter brand. Manufacturers often issue updates to ensure customer safety.
4. Test Functionality
Periodically test your adapters to ensure they are functioning correctly. If an adapter starts acting erratically, it is time for a replacement.
5. Follow Manufacturer Instructions
Always adhere to the manufacturer's guidelines for usage and maintenance. This practice ensures optimal performance and safety.
Frequently Asked Questions
1. What is the difference between an adapter and a converter?
An adapter allows different plug types to connect, while a converter changes voltage and current types. Some devices may require both.
2. Can I use any adapter with my device?
No, using an incompatible adapter can damage your device. Always check voltage and amperage compatibility.
3. How do I know if my adapter is safe?
Look for safety certifications and choose reputable brands. Regular inspections can also identify potential issues.
4. Are travel adapters safe to use?
Travel adapters can be safe if they meet safety standards and are compatible with the devices you intend to use. Always check the voltage requirements.
5. What should I do if my adapter overheats?
Immediately disconnect the adapter from the power source and allow it to cool. If overheating persists, replace the adapter.
